树莓派因其小巧的体积和低功耗的特点,在DIY项目和小型服务器中得到了广泛的应用。为了防止数据丢失,定期备份树莓派的硬盘数据显得尤为重要。使用dd命令进行数据备份是一种高效且可靠的方法。下面,我将详细讲解如何在树莓派上使用dd命令进行硬盘数据备份。
前期准备
在开始之前,请确保以下准备工作已经完成:
- 一块足够大的存储介质,如USB闪存盘或外部硬盘,用于存放备份的数据。
- 树莓派的SSH访问权限,以便远程操作。
- 已安装
dd命令,大多数Linux发行版默认已包含此命令。
步骤一:连接存储介质
首先,将你准备好的存储介质(USB闪存盘或外部硬盘)连接到树莓派。
步骤二:查看存储介质
在树莓派的终端中,输入以下命令来查看连接的存储介质:
lsblk
这将列出所有可用的块设备。注意查看你的存储介质的设备名称,例如 /dev/sdb。
步骤三:创建备份文件
在树莓派的终端中,创建一个新文件来存储备份的数据。例如,我们可以创建一个名为 raspberrypi-backup.img 的文件:
dd if=/dev/mmcblk0 of=/path/to/raspberrypi-backup.img bs=4M status=progress
这里,if=/dev/mmcblk0 表示输入文件,即树莓派的原始硬盘;of=/path/to/raspberrypi-backup.img 表示输出文件,即备份文件存放的位置和名称;bs=4M 表示每次读取4MB的数据,status=progress 表示在备份过程中显示进度。
请确保将 /path/to/raspberrypi-backup.img 替换为你的存储介质的实际路径。
步骤四:开始备份
运行上述命令后,dd 命令将开始从树莓派的硬盘读取数据并将其写入到备份文件中。这个过程可能需要一段时间,具体时间取决于你的硬盘大小和读写速度。
步骤五:验证备份
备份完成后,你可以使用以下命令来验证备份文件:
md5sum /path/to/raspberrypi-backup.img
这将输出备份文件的MD5校验和。你可以将这个校验和与你之前记录的校验和进行比较,以确保备份文件的一致性。
步骤六:安全断开存储介质
备份完成后,安全地断开存储介质。
注意事项
- 在执行
dd命令时,请确保输出文件的路径正确,以避免覆盖重要数据。 - 如果备份文件过大,可能需要将其分割成更小的部分,以便于存储和传输。
- 在进行备份操作时,请确保树莓派稳定运行,避免在备份过程中断电。
通过以上步骤,你就可以在树莓派上使用dd命令轻松实现硬盘数据的备份了。这是一种高效且可靠的方法,可以确保你的数据安全无忧。
